Luggage

Each company operating between Amalfi and Minori has its own luggage policy:

  • Travelmar allows passengers to bring 1 piece of hand luggage with a maximum size of 45x35x20 cm.
  • On Grassi Junior ferries, you can bring your luggage on board by paying an additional fee of €2.

Pets on board

You can travel with your pet on the ferry to Minori from Amalfi. Pets normally travel with a €5 ticket.

Smaller animals must be kept in special carriers, while large-sized animals should wear a muzzle and a leash.

Where to take the ferry from Amalfi to Minori

Usually, ferries to Minori depart from Molo Cassone, located at the port of Amalfi.

You can walk to the port from the town center, as it is just a 10-minute walk from Sant'Andrea's cathedral, a symbol of the ancient maritime city.

How long is the ferry ride from Amalfi to Minori?

The Amalfi - Minori ferry trip usually takes between 10 min and 15 min.

You can't bring your vehicle on the ferry to Minori from Amalfi as the ferry trip is only operated by high-speed ferries.

Useful info: if you plan to drive to Minori, keep in mind that there is no free parking in the Amalfi area. The only option is to park your car in a paid parking lot, which usually costs between €2 and €5 per hour.

The distance between the port of Amalfi and Minori is 2 nautical miles (around 3 km).

The ferry connection from Amalfi to Minori is operated only by high-speed boats.
